Two Tributes in Verse

Macaulay's "Horatius at the Bridge."

Then out spake brave Horatius,
The Captain of the gate:
“To every man upon this earth
Death cometh soon or late.
And how can man die better
Than facing fearful odds
For the ashes of his fathers
And the temples of his gods,

“And for the tender mother
Who dandled him to rest,
And for the wife who nurses
His baby at her breast,
And for the holy maidens
Who feed the eternal flame,—


And an inscription on a soldiers' memorial:

Let The Stranger
Who May In Future Times
Read this Inscription,
Recognize That These Were Men
Whom Power Could Not Corrupt,
Whom Death Could Not Terrify,
Whom Defeat Could Not Dishonor.
And Let Their Virtue Plead
For Just Judgment
Of the Cause in Which They Perished;
Let the Citizen
Of Another Generation
Remember
That the State Taught Them
How to Live and How to Die,
And That From Her Broken Fortunes
She Has Preserved for Her Children
The Priceless Treasures of Their Memories;
Teaching All Who May Claim
The Same Birthright,
That Truth, Courage, And Patriotism
Endureth Forever.

Happy Memorial Day!

I hope you have a great day, but please spend some time thinking about the 625,000 Americans killed in the Civil War, the 116,000 killed in WWI, the 405,000 killed in WWII, the 36,000 killed in the Korean War, the 58,000 killed in the Vietnam War, the 2,300 killed in the Afghanistan War, the 4,500 killed in the Iraq war, and all the Americans killed in other wars...
